What is the best time to visit South Korea?
The best time to visit South Korea is during spring and autumn when the weather is mild and the natural scenery is particularly beautiful with cherry blossoms in spring and vibrant foliage in autumn.
How many days should I spend in South Korea for a typical trip?
A typical trip to South Korea lasts between one to two weeks, which allows enough time to explore major cities and surrounding regions at a comfortable pace.

How many days should I spend in Seoul?
Spending around 4 to 5 days in Seoul is common to fully experience its cultural sites, shopping districts, and modern attractions.
What are the best areas to stay in Seoul?
Popular areas to stay in Seoul include Myeongdong for shopping, Insadong for traditional culture, and Gangnam for nightlife and modern amenities.
What are popular day trips from Seoul?
Popular day trips from Seoul include visits to the DMZ area near Paju, historic sites in Suwon, and scenic nature spots like Nami Island.
